Output 608a913061ba459d72fa17327ea8fa7a1cd1229d889bdf85fe65f0583f56d3b9:1

value
64900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d2ce9d045501213a8872c7014e1403cd1a1bae OP_EQUAL
address
3QTxiSchca69dmS6eo4qvHYsAtu8WxuqnW
transaction
608a913061ba459d72fa17327ea8fa7a1cd1229d889bdf85fe65f0583f56d3b9
confirmations
501268
spent
true